Emacs не показывает имя файла

Где когда-то было имя файла, теперь есть черная полоса, мешая мне видеть, что я редактирую.

введите описание изображения здесь

Чтобы немного уточнить, это черная полоса между «F1» и «All», когда я сделал снимок экрана, я редактировал файл .emacs.

Я запускаю GNU Emacs 23.2.1 (с флагами -nw ) на Ubuntu 11.04.

Я попытался выполнить emacs -q , появится графический интерфейс, и имя файла будет правильно читаемым.

Вот мои .emacs:

 (defconst user-init-dir '~/Dropbox/emacs) (add-to-list 'load-path "~/Dropbox/emacs") (add-to-list 'load-path "~/Dropbox/clojure/clojure-mode") (require 'clojure-mode) (eval-after-load "slime" '(progn (slime-setup '(slime-repl)))) (add-to-list 'load-path "~/Dropbox/emacs/slime") (require 'slime) (slime-setup) ;;line numbers (global-linum-mode) ;;parens highlight (show-paren-mode 1) (require 'package) (add-to-list 'package-archives '("marmalade" . "http://marmalade-repo.org/packages/")) ;;steve yegge's js mode http://code.google.com/p/js2-mode/wiki/InstallationInstructions (setq load-path (append (list (expand-file-name "~/Dropbox/emacs/js2")) load-path)) (autoload 'js2-mode "js2" nil t) (add-to-list 'auto-mode-alist '("\\.js$" . js2-mode)) ;;save how the session was when i exited http://www.gnu.org/s/libtool/manual/emacs/Saving-Emacs-Sessions.html (desktop-save-mode 1) 

EDIT: К сожалению, это кажется больше, чем я думал, кажется, более широкая конфигурация цветов, которые каким-то образом я изменился, я почти уверен в этом, потому что теперь man не показывает буквы букв для переключателей на своих страницах и доработки в emacs не показаны.

Во всяком случае, это только ради полноты, может быть, я открою новый вопрос об этом после того, как я искал немного больше …

Имя буфера находится в лицевой mode-line-buffer-id , примененной над лицом mode-line . По умолчанию на темном фоне в терминале mode-line находится в черном по белому, а mode-line-buffer-id выделен жирным шрифтом; возможно, вы случайно дали ему черный план.